Smith (September 17, 1928 – March 20, 2024) [1] was an American wrestler and Olympic champion in freestyle wrestling at the 1952 Olympic Games. Smith was born in Portland, Oregon and graduated from Thomas Jefferson Senior High School in Council Bluffs, Iowa. [2]

NettetJohn William Smith (born August 9, 1965) is an American folkstyle and freestyle wrestler and coach. He is a two-time NCAA Division I national champion, and a six-time world and Olympic champion. As of June 2024, he has won more world-level gold medals in wrestling than any other American. John T. Smith [3] [1] (born April 25, 1967) is an American retired professional wrestler, better known by his ring name, J. T. Smith. He is best known for his appearances with Extreme Championship Wrestling in the 1990s.
